Analysis
The most recent figure for child mortality rate including un projections through 2100 in Finland is 0.252, measured in 2023.
Compared with earlier readings it is down 14.5% on the previous year and up 9.9% over ten years.
Over the whole period, child mortality rate including un projections through 2100 in Finland peaked at 5.08 in 1950 and was at its lowest, 0.2099, in 2015.
Finland ranks 217th of 229 countries on this measure, in the bottom quarter.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.
